From what we understand, you are interested in streaming content from your iPad using the AirPlay feature. This can be a useful way to play videos on your Apple TV. It is important to note that you may still need to sign in to your video apps on your iPad before streaming. Also, some apps do not support AirPlay features. Finally, as it turns out, you can connect a Bluetooth keyboard to your Apple TV and use it to sign in to apps with. The following article explains which settings you’ll want to access when connecting a Bluetooth accessory with your Apple TV:
